Output 45a331503979b69114f6217a112c1d434e243c543c5f7b5fe05ccdf5355dd64e: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af35de0c148c8f9ad3515228de5e12d88bd769d8 OP_EQUAL
address
3HfShtGLk9T3DNfcxnpWqmDbYNXvJdC7P1
transaction
45a331503979b69114f6217a112c1d434e243c543c5f7b5fe05ccdf5355dd64e